在当今快速发展的 Web 开发领域,构建一个响应迅速、交互性强且易于维护的 Web 应用已成为每个开发者的目标,Vue.js,作为一个轻量级、高性能的 JavaScript 框架,凭借其简洁的语法和强大的功能集,已经成为了众多开发者的首选,而 Vue Router,作为 Vue.js 官方提供的路由管理工具,更是让开发者能够轻松地构建单页面应用(SPA),本文将深入探讨如何利用 Vue.js 和 Vue Router 结合 CDN(内容分发网络)技术来构建一个现代化的 Web 应用。
Vue.js 简介
Vue.js 是一个用于构建用户界面的渐进式 JavaScript 框架,它的核心理念是数据驱动和组件化,这意味着开发者可以通过简单的 API 调用来创建和管理复杂的用户界面,Vue.js 具有以下特点:
轻量级:Vue.js 的体积非常小,压缩后大约只有 10KB,适合快速加载和高性能要求的应用。
渐进增强:你可以选择性地使用其功能,从简单的模板到完整的功能集都可以按需引入。
组件化:通过将应用程序分解为更小、更独立的组件,可以更容易地进行复用和维护。
虚拟DOM:Vue.js 使用虚拟 DOM 技术来提高性能和跨平台兼容性。
Vue Router 概述
Vue Router 是官方推出的一个用于管理应用中不同页面路由的工具,它提供了一种简单的方式来连接不同的 URL 与相应的视图组件,Vue Router 的主要特性包括:
嵌套路路:允许你定义深层嵌套的路由结构,使得应用的组织更加直观。
导航守卫:提供全局前置守卫、路由独享的守卫以及全局后置守卫,让你能够控制导航的逻辑。
路由参数:支持传递动态参数给路由组件,实现更灵活的数据绑定。
编程式导航:通过router
对象提供的 API,可以实现复杂的导航逻辑。
CDN 加速与优化
在现代 Web 应用的开发中,CDN(内容分发网络)技术扮演着至关重要的角色,通过将静态资源如 HTML、CSS、JavaScript、图片等文件部署到全球分布的服务器上,用户可以就近获取这些资源,从而显著减少延迟和带宽消耗,对于使用 CDN 加速你的 Web 应用,以下是一些关键点:
CDN的选择与配置
选择一个合适的 CDN 服务商是关键的第一步,常见的 CDN 包括 Cloudflare、Akamai、Amazon CloudFront 等,在选择 CDN 时,需要考虑以下因素:
覆盖范围:选择覆盖范围广泛的 CDN 确保全球用户的访问速度都能得到保障。
价格与成本:根据你的预算选择最合适的服务计划。
服务质量:查看不同 CDN 服务商的性能指标和客户评价。
技术支持:确保所选服务商能提供及时有效的技术支持。
CDN集成策略
将你的 Web 应用集成到 CDN,通常需要以下几个步骤:
1、配置域名解析:将你的域名指向 CDN服务商的 IP地址,通常是通过修改域名的 NS(Name Server)记录来实现。
2、设置缓存规则:根据资源的类型和更新频率,设置合理的缓存规则以平衡性能和资源更新的需求,对于不经常变动的内容可以设置较长的缓存时间,而对于频繁更新的内容则应设置较短的缓存时间或采用动态缓存策略。
3、优化资源文件:对 HTML、CSS、JavaScript 文件进行压缩和合并处理,减少文件大小和请求次数,合理组织资源的加载顺序和使用懒加载技术以提高加载效率。
4、监控与优化:持续监控应用的性能指标(如页面加载时间、HTTP请求数等),并根据分析结果不断调整 CDN的配置策略和资源优化措施。
Vue.js + Vue Router + CDN = Web应用的未来
通过将 Vue.js、Vue Router 以及 CDN技术相结合,我们可以构建出既美观又高效的现代 Web 应用,这种组合不仅能够提供快速响应的用户界面和流畅的用户体验,还能够有效地降低开发和维护成本,CDN的使用还能帮助应对全球分布式的用户群体,确保无论用户身在何处都能获得最佳的访问体验。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态